Advertisement

Spring框架中JdbcTemplate的查询方法介绍

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本篇文章主要介绍了在Spring框架下的JdbcTemplate类及其常用查询数据库的方法。适合初学者了解和学习Spring框架的数据访问技术。 本段落介绍了在 Spring 2.5.6 SEC02 和 JDK1.4 环境下使用 Spring 框架中的 org.springframework.jdbc.core 包提供的 JdbcTemplate 类进行 JDBC 操作的方法。JdbcTemplate 是 core 包的核心类,其他模板类都是基于它封装完成的。此外,Spring 还提供了 NamedParameterJdbcTemplate 类用于支持命名参数绑定和 SimpleJdbcTemplate 类。本段落重点介绍了 Spring 框架中 JdbcTemplate 类的查询方法。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• SpringJdbcTemplate
    优质
    本篇文章主要介绍了在Spring框架下的JdbcTemplate类及其常用查询数据库的方法。适合初学者了解和学习Spring框架的数据访问技术。 本段落介绍了在 Spring 2.5.6 SEC02 和 JDK1.4 环境下使用 Spring 框架中的 org.springframework.jdbc.core 包提供的 JdbcTemplate 类进行 JDBC 操作的方法。JdbcTemplate 是 core 包的核心类,其他模板类都是基于它封装完成的。此外,Spring 还提供了 NamedParameterJdbcTemplate 类用于支持命名参数绑定和 SimpleJdbcTemplate 类。本段落重点介绍了 Spring 框架中 JdbcTemplate 类的查询方法。
  • Spring JdbcTemplate 实例讲解
    优质
    本教程详细介绍了如何使用Spring框架中的JdbcTemplate类执行数据库查询操作,并提供了实用示例以帮助开发者更好地理解和应用这些技术。 关于Spring JdbcTemplate的query方法使用示例,欢迎参考并借鉴。
  • MySQL模糊四种
    优质
    本文将详细介绍在MySQL数据库中进行模糊查询时可以采用的四种常用方法,帮助读者掌握灵活的数据检索技巧。 MySQL中的模糊查询是一种强大的数据检索方法,允许用户使用特定的通配符来匹配不确定的数据内容。本段落将详细介绍四种常见的MySQL模糊查询用法,帮助你在处理数据库查询时更加灵活高效。 1. **百分号(%)**:在模糊查询中,百分号代表任意数量的字符,包括零个字符。例如,`SELECT * FROM user WHERE u_name LIKE %三%` 将返回所有包含“三”的记录,无论其前后有多少字符。如果你处理的是中文数据,则可能需要使用双百分号(%%)来匹配单个中文字符。同时需要注意,“LIKE %三%猫%”与“LIKE %三% AND LIKE %猫%”的区别:前者只能找到含有连续的“三”和“猫”的记录,而后者可以找到两者在任意位置出现的情况。 2. **下划线(_)**:下划线代表单个字符。例如,“SELECT * FROM user WHERE u_name LIKE _三_”将找出所有中间为“三”,前后各有一个字符的记录,如唐三藏。“SELECT * FROM user WHERE u_name LIKE 三__”则会找到以“三”开头,并且后面跟着任意两个字符的记录,比如“三脚猫”。 3. **方括号([ ])**:方括号用于定义一个特定的字符集来匹配其中的一个或多个字符。例如,“SELECT * FROM user WHERE u_name LIKE [张李王]三”将找出名字为张三、李三或者王三的所有记录。“老[1-9]”可以用来查找所有以“老1至老9”的开头的名字。 4. **反向方括号([^ ])**:与普通方括号相反,反向方括号用于排除特定字符集中的任何一个单个字符。例如,“SELECT * FROM user WHERE u_name LIKE [^张李王]三”会找出除“张、李、王”外姓氏的“三”,如赵三。“老[^1-4]”则可以用来查找所有以“老5至老9”的开头的名字。 当查询内容包含特殊字符,比如百分号(%)、下划线(_)或方括号时,可能会导致查询异常。为了解决这个问题,你可以事先编写一个`sqlencode`函数来替换这些可能引起问题的符号:将分号(;)变为双分号(;;),将[和]分别替换成[[[]]]和[_],以及将百分号(%)变更为[%]。 掌握这四种模糊查询技巧能够显著提升你在MySQL中的数据检索能力,并帮助你更准确地定位所需的信息。在实际应用中根据具体需求灵活使用这些方法可以提高查询效率并增强数据库管理的准确性。
  • Spring MVC与应用
    优质
    简介:本文详细介绍了Spring MVC框架的基本概念、架构及工作原理,并通过实例讲解了其在Web开发中的具体应用。 Spring MVC框架是基于Spring框架的一种设计模式实现方式,它是一种用于构建Web应用程序的模型-视图-控制器(MVC)架构。使用该框架可以简化开发流程,并且能够快速地搭建起一个结构清晰、逻辑严谨的应用系统。 在实际项目中应用Spring MVC时,通常会遵循以下步骤: 1. **配置DispatcherServlet**:这是整个处理请求的核心组件,负责接收HTTP请求并根据其中的信息调用相应的处理器来响应用户请求。 2. **定义Controller类**:这些类主要用来处理用户的业务逻辑。每个控制器方法都对应着一个具体的URL路径和HTTP方法(如GET、POST等),并且可以返回ModelAndView对象以设置视图名称及模型数据。 3. **创建ViewResolver配置**:用于将逻辑视图名解析为实际的物理视图资源,比如JSP页面的位置。通过这种机制,可以让前端展示层与业务逻辑分离开来。 以上就是Spring MVC框架的基本介绍及其常用套路说明,在实践中还需要根据具体需求灵活运用这些技术来构建高效稳定的Web应用项目。
  • JdbcTemplate 操作
    优质
    简介:JdbcTemplate是Spring框架提供的一个用于简化 JDBC 编程的类,它封装了数据库查询和更新操作,支持SQL执行、参数设置及结果集处理等,极大提高了Java持久层编码效率。 JdbcTemplate是一个用于操作数据库的框架工具。鉴于它在开发中的广泛应用,我们有必要去了解它。
  • COBIT 2019指南(文版).pdf
    优质
    《COBIT 2019框架介绍与方法指南》中文版为IT管理人员提供了全面指导,帮助理解和实施COBIT框架,以优化企业IT治理和管理。 COBIT-2019框架是一个全面的指导工具,旨在帮助企业管理和优化IT流程与服务。它提供了关于如何高效利用信息技术来支持组织业务目标的具体建议,并且涵盖了从战略规划到日常操作的所有方面。此框架强调了治理和管理的最佳实践,帮助企业和机构确保其信息和技术资源的有效使用,同时促进风险管理、合规性和价值创造。 COBIT-2019通过提供一系列模型、流程以及评估工具来支持IT管理和审计活动的执行与改进。它不仅关注于技术层面的操作细节,还注重从高层战略视角审视整个组织的信息科技架构和业务目标之间的关系。此外,该框架强调了不同利益相关者的需求,并提倡一种协作的方式来进行决策制定。 总之,COBIT-2019为企业提供了一个实用且全面的方法论来指导其IT治理实践的发展和完善。
  • Struts(详细Struts
    优质
    简介:Struts框架是一种用于开发基于Java的web应用程序的开源软件框架,它遵循MVC设计模式,使开发者能够快速构建高效、灵活的应用程序。 Struts框架详细介绍 Struts框架详细介绍 Struts框架详细介绍 Struts框架详细介绍
  • Spring内置JdbcTemplate和插入预编译操作
    优质
    本文章介绍了Spring框架中JdbcTemplate类用于数据库查询与插入操作时如何使用预编译语句,提高应用安全性和执行效率。 简单介绍jdbcTemplate的预编译功能及回调机制。在使用jdbcTemplate进行数据库操作时,可以通过设置SQL语句为预编译状态来提高执行效率并增强安全性。此外,通过实现特定接口或继承抽象类的方式,可以利用回调方法灵活处理查询结果和事务控制等复杂场景。